Looking for som some clarification on one of the questions on the pilot application to make sure i’m providing the most accurate information. On the “Checkride Failure” tab it asks "Have you failed any FAA checkride (not including stage checks)” however on the “Flying Status” tab it asks "Have you ever been removed from flight status, downgraded, or failed any portion of flight training either civilian or military?” and does not reference stage checks. I do not have any FAA checkride failures, but I do have one unsatisfactory Part 141 Stage Check. Is the intent on the “Flying Status” tab to mark “Yes” if I have an unsatisfactory attempt at a Part 141 Stage check?

Your answer is no then. Same applied to me and I answered no. Came up in the interview, I disclosed it. But the HR person was like. It’s still a no.

I still got the job and here in training. Sometimes, you have to answer the question and not read into it too much.
